Supreme Court deadlocks, leaves in place block on nation’s first religious charter school

The U.S. Supreme Court on May 22 voted 4–4 to reject authorization for the nation’s first publicly funded religious charter school. 5 Takeaways from Supreme Court hearing on nationwide injunctions, birthright citizenship

The Supreme Court on May 15 heard oral arguments in relation to the Trump administration’s request to lift nationwide injunctions placed on the president’s birthright citizenship order. The decision could determine how judges can address presidential actions.
